The L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C belongs to the category of Field Programmable Gate Arrays (FPGAs).
This FPGA is primarily used in electronic circuits for digital logic implementation, prototyping, and system integration.

The L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C has a total of 1,156 pins, each serving a specific purpose in the circuit design. The pin configuration includes input/output pins, power supply pins, clock pins, and configuration pins. A detailed pinout diagram can be found in the product datasheet.
The L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C operates based on the principles of reconfigurable computing. It consists of a matrix of programmable logic elements interconnected through configurable routing resources. The device can be programmed to implement desired digital logic functions by configuring the interconnections between logic elements.

Q: What is the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C? A: The L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C is a specific model of Field-Programmable Gate Array (FPGA) manufactured by Lattice Semiconductor.
Q: What are the key features of the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C? A: The L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C offers features such as high-performance logic fabric, embedded memory blocks, high-speed I/O interfaces, and low power consumption.
Q: In what applications can the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C be used? A: The L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C can be used in various applications including telecommunications, industrial automation, automotive electronics, medical devices, and aerospace systems.
Q: What is the maximum number of logic elements available in the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C? A: The L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C has a maximum of 70,000 logic elements (LEs) that can be utilized for implementing complex digital designs.
Q: Can the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C support high-speed serial communication protocols? A: Yes, the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C supports high-speed serial communication protocols such as PCIe, Gigabit Ethernet, USB, and SATA.
Q: Does the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C have built-in memory resources? A: Yes, the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C includes embedded memory blocks (RAM) that can be used for data storage and processing.
Q: What is the power consumption of the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C? A: The power consumption of the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C varies depending on the design implementation, but it is designed to be power-efficient.
Q: Can the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C be reprogrammed after deployment? A: Yes, the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C is a field-programmable device, which means it can be reprogrammed even after it has been deployed in a system.
Q: What development tools are available for programming the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C? A: Lattice Semiconductor provides software tools like Lattice Diamond and Lattice Radiant for designing, simulating, and programming the LFE3-70EA-9FN1156C.
